【问题标题】:Django FileBrowser-No-Grappelli images not loadingDjango FileBrowser-No-Grappelli 图像未加载
【发布时间】:2014-04-29 13:17:11
【问题描述】:

我已经安装了 django file-browser-no-grappelli

我可以在后端使用它,但图像无法通过我收到 404 错误。

/media/uploads/products/el45bg_admin_thumbnail.jpg HTTP/1.1" 404 2608

我已将设置添加到我的 settings.py 中

STATIC_URL = '/static/'
MEDIA_URL = '/media/'
MEDIA_ROOT = os.path.join(BASE_DIR, 'media')
DIRECTORY = os.path.join(BASE_DIR, 'media' 'uploads')
FILEBROWSER_ADMIN_THUMBNAIL = 'admin_thumbnail'
FILEBROWSER_ADMIN_VERSIONS = ['thumbnail', 'small', 'medium', 'big', 'large']
VERSIONS_BASEDIR = "versions"

目录已创建,我可以通过管理界面创建更多目录并上传调整大小的文件。

所以我想知道为什么图像不会出现?正如我已经完成了 readthedocs 上的指南所述的所有内容。

【问题讨论】:

  • 会不会是访问问题?你可以上传图片到那个目录,但是你不能下载它们?也许您需要将要访问的图像放在另一个目录中(例如在 /static 下)。

标签: python django django-filebrowser


【解决方案1】:

已修复,我需要添加

  • static(settings.MEDIA_URL, document_root=settings.MEDIA_ROOT) 到我的 urls.py

【讨论】:

    猜你喜欢
    • 2013-02-17
    • 1970-01-01
    • 2019-07-24
    • 1970-01-01
    • 2021-01-23
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2015-11-24
    相关资源
    最近更新 更多